Applicant's name: Charles Catlett Applicant's institution: ANL Applicant's division: MCS Project Name: UrbanCrime Project title: Urban Crime and Weather: An Empirical Study Associated funding: Arnold Foundation, LDRD Other Systems: None Science: The project is an empirical analysis of violent crime events and weather data, using clustering and machine learning algorithms to test hypotheses related to the effect of changes in weather on the probability of violent crime events in urban environments. Project description: The project uses Chicago crime data and NOAA weather data, applying various algorithms to the data to determine interrelationships between violent crime events and weather changes. Software is primarily Python and R, and runs out of memory on a desktop system. This project aims to explore how HPC resources could be used to meet the demands of current studies, and to prepare for much larger data sources including (a) crimes from additional cities, and (b) higher resolution weather data.
